The Russian by Saul Herzog

Moscow, Russia
The Kremlin activates a deadly assassin.
Across the city, a massive bombing kills hundreds.

Washington DC, USA
The President believes the Kremlin is preparing for a new Cold War.

Langley, USA
With the world on the brink, the CIA has only one asset capable of preventing catastrophe, but that man is AWOL. They have to find him.

But some men don't want to be found.

The Russian by Saul Herzog is the stunning second instalment in the series that has taken the publishing industry, and Hollywood rights departments, by storm.
